China is the new beauty center

Plastic surgery is not a new story nowadays, even people feel familiar with the concept.

The “cutlery” is popular all over the world. In which, people often refer to Korea as the “capital” of plastic surgery. Besides, China is also emerging as the center.

According to the 2019 Global Statistical Report of the International Association of Aesthetic Plastic Surgery, China ranks third in the number of cosmetic surgeries as well as the frequency for medical tourism.

They predict that China’s cosmetic market could surpass 310 billion yuan by 2023. Statistics from Statista – a German consumer data and market specialist said in 2018, 22 million people have had plastic surgery in China, a sevenfold increase in the past decade.

The development of aesthetic skill and the companionship of technology make plastic surgery in China easier than ever. Just download the app, you can find a way to fix it on your face, then schedule a surgery in a moment.

13, 14 years old had plastic surgery

The growth rate of China’s domestic cosmetic market is higher than that of the global market. In which, women aged 20-35 are the main driving force of consumption. Plastic surgery is no longer considered taboo in Chinese culture.

Instead of limiting reconstructive procedures to restoring appearance to patients with facial deformities or birth defects, many Chinese have embraced the benefits of plastic surgery.

The phenomenon of “pre-teen” girls having plastic surgery makes people surprised.

Especially as the younger generation becomes richer and their views are also more liberal. They believe that good looks are an advantage. Usually, people think that only older people look to plastic surgery to change facial features and restore youthfulness. However, in China the age is getting younger day by day. It is noteworthy that there are cases only 13, 14 years old.

Born in 2004 but Nana has “cutlery” since the age of 13 with more than 60 cases.

For example, the case of a girl born in 2004 named Nana. She publicly announced that she had plastic surgery from the age of 13 with 60 repair cases and the cost of up to 11 billion VND. However, people are afraid of her face behind the cutlery and consider it a “snake face”.

Or like Wu Xiao Chen, she said that when she was 14 years old, she had her first cosmetic procedure. It was the thigh liposuction paid for by her mother. During the 16 years since that first surgery, she has undergone more than 100 other surgeries at a cost of 4 million yuan (about 14 billion dong).

Wu Xiao Chen continues to have plastic surgery even though her appearance is not ugly.

“Not pretty enough” – that’s what many people affirm when asked why plastic surgery. They are willing to spend a lot of money, take pain to change their appearance. Especially the concept, early surgery – early beauty.

However, many people assert that “cutlery” is not the best way, especially when you are too young, it can lead to a series of complications. There’s nothing wrong with plastic surgery, but it shouldn’t be turned into an obsession.
